 Original Article
XML Diagnostic and Epidemiologic Features of Hepatitis C among Hemodialysis Patients Living in Yazd Province of Iran P. 25-30
M Baghbanian *, AA Karimi-Bondarabadi, M Doosti, M Shayestehpour, H Salmanroghani, H Keyvani, S Dastamouz, A Ahmadi, Z Moallemi, M Shahidokht
Abstract (4298 Views)   |   Full-Text (PDF) (997 Downloads)     |   Highlights
  • HCV prevalence using ELISA and RT-PCR tests among hemodialysis patients living in Yazd provenance of Iran is 6.3% and 2.1%, respectively.
  • Risk factors are the hemodialysis duration (p<0.001) and kidney transplantation (p=0.005).
